It's going to be a very tough and nervous six months until the season starts again. Everything is now up in the air and so many things could potentially change. Whether or not it was the right thing to do there are going to be many ramifications:

- There is a now a strong possibilty of a player clean-out with all Peckett, Powell and Thompson likely to go. Players such as Brooks, Ferguson, Murray, McGough were already on very shaky ground. There is also many players who the new coach might not see as part of the future such as Ackland, Blake, Fiora, Milne and Schwarze.

- Harvey won't be pushed out the door by the new coach, but given the circumstances he might not want to stay anymore becuase he might not want to be involved with the club while it has all this insecurity. After a shaky start Thomas and Gehrig seemed to have a good relationship which held Gehrig in good stead mentally. If the next coach and Gehrig were not on the same page he might walk out of the club. However, it is fairly unlikely this will happen.

- Both Clarkes, Hamill's and Kosi's future are now a bit unclear. Thomas always seemed to give them his full backing which always kept them safe. I can't imagine that whoever comes in will get rid of any of these four but you never know. He may think the club needs a revamp.

- The players were supposebly very close to GT. I'm not sure what effect it will have on the players but I imagine they'd be fairly upset. I hope there doesn't become a rift between the players and board. I think it's very unlikely any players will leave the club but once one player leaves a few othermight leave as well.

- The rotation policy will now more than likely be dropped and the captaincy will probably go back to Nick. It will be good for Nick because it will give him the captaincy for 5 years and give him the chance to become Carey-like. But, on the other hand I wonder if it will have any effect on Bally given that the captaincy will be taken off him when there is no longer a rotating policy.

- We could now potentially become a big player in trade week with Gardiner, Everitt and Acker all on the market. GT had virtually ruled out all of them but the new coach might be interested innthem as they are the type of players we lack. I don't know whether this is good or not but I'd rather see us going for younger players.

- Another worrying thing is that it is virtually impossible for a first year coach to win a premiership. Normally, it takes a few years for the coach to grow into the role.

I hope that we can find a good coach, but at the moment there doesn't seem to be a lot of experienced coaches around which would mean we are more than likely going to have a first time coach which is a risk. I wouldn't mind Matt Rendell though. It will also be interesting to see if Jason Misfud is retained, as GT basically single-handedly recruited him from the bush.
